Explain Star topology.
A network utilizes a star topology if each computer attach to a central point. The following figure demonstrates the concept:
Star Topology
Since a star shaped network resembles the spoke of a wheel, center of a star network is often termed as a hub. While practice, star network seldom have a symmetric shape in that the hub is located at identical distance from all computers. As an alternative a hub frequently resides in a location separate from the computers attached to this.
